VIDEO: Governor Peter Mbah fulfils threat, seal off Shops for observing Monday Sit-at-home in Enugu

July 24, 2023
in Enugu State

Enugu State Governor, Mr. Peter Mbah has fulfilled his threat of sealing off Shops and Marketplaces if traders in Enugu observed Monday’s sit-at-home an order allegedly issued by the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B).

AbaCityBlog reports that although, IPOB has on several occasions denied issuing the sit-at-home order, however, some non state actors have been enforcing the sit-at-home order in the South-East region, leading to destruction of business places and lost of lives.

Frowning over the sit-at-home order, Governor Mbah had last week Monday threatened to cease shops and licenses of any trader who obeyed the order henceforth starting today.

The governor warned that traders, who continued to sit at home from Monday, July 24, stood to lose their shops to serious-minded businessmen.

While adding that adequate security had been provided in the areas, adding that there had not been any incident of attack since the ban on sit-at-home in June.

According to the governor, “The poverty that will befall us for sitting at home will kill us even faster. We are losing over N10 billion every Monday that we sit at home. Enough is enough. This foolishness must end and it must end now. We cannot be marginalising ourselves and still complain of marginalisation.

“So, we must say no to sit-at-home because what it means is that we are destroying our employment, our economy, and our GDP,” Governor Mbah said.

Governor Peter Mbah Seal Off Shops In Enugu

In a viral video obtained by AbaCityBlog, Governor Mbah with his entourage in his usual tour today seal off ShopRite for obeying the sit-at-home order.

A source said the governor also seal off many other shops in the State and market places where traders stay at home and refused to open their shop today.
